1

我有一个 javascript 轮播库,它定义了我的图像所在的容器。我的图像的宽度和高度必须设置为 100%,以便它们是容器的大小并随容器调整大小。当页面加载 ie 时,大概在加载 javascript 之前,图像会以页面的 100% 的宽度闪烁,因为 java 还没有加载容器?

我的页面在 php 中,它没有在 html 中执行此操作,因此可能是由于 php 加载方式所致?

有没有办法让 javascript 在图像之前加载或停止显示页面以便看不到闪烁的图像?

谢谢

4

2 回答 2

1

您可能想要使用jquery图像预加载器。

它首先加载所有 javascript,然后静默地预加载它们,而不在页面加载期间更改显示

于 2011-04-06T09:50:48.393 回答
1

使图像周围的 div 显示:无,然后使用文档准备好的东西来显示它。JS 在页面加载后运行,例如:在图像之后等。

于 2011-04-06T09:45:36.103 回答